6. Day of Knowledge – September 1
If you see students with white ribbons and they hold flowers, it means that today
is a Day of Knowledge – September 1.
7. Student Parliament
In our school we have active and creative groups of students who organize all
performances and publish our school newspaper ,,We”.
8. Creativity in School
All our students are very active and take part in the school choir and
theatre, vocal bands, national and popular dances, debates. We are
proud that our parents are active participants of our school’s life.
9. Our Holiday Traditions
Most popular holidays in our school are Teacher’s Day and Christmas and
New Years party. A favourite holiday of our teachers is Teacher’s Day, when
students congratulate teachers, say sweet words, give presents. Students also like
this holiday, because lessons are shorter and instead of teachers senior students
run lessons.
After Christmas we have New Year’s party! Each class prepares a unique
performance. Masks, games, songs, dances, Santa Claus, Christmas tree and a lot
of fun all around the school.

11. Last Bell & Leavers’ Party
O Last Bell is memorable because 9th
and 12th
class students go to school
like first class students and there
the last bell rings for them.
School’s over for them!
O School-leavers’ day is a
special ball, when girls
look like princesses, but
boys are real gentlemen!
This is the day when
graduates get their
certificates.
